系统中很多地方都可以使用通配符,如写SQL条件,字段默认值,需要写SQL的地方等。
通配符列表:
$userid$:当前登录用户的ID。
$username$:当前登录用户的姓名。
$deptid$:当前登录用户的部门ID。
$deptname$:当前登录用户的部门名称。
$unitid$:当前用户所在单位ID。
$unitname$:当前用户所在单位名称。
$account$:当前用户账号。
$querystring:获取URL参数值,写法:$querystring&flowid&$,中间的flowid为要查询的参数名称。
$queryform:获取POST的参数值,写法:$queryform&参数名称&$。
$date:用当前日期时间替换字符串,写法:$date&日期时间格式&$。例:$date&yyyyMMdd&$。
$datarow:获取一个System.Data.DataRow中的一个字段值,调用的时候要将DataRow作为参数传入,public static string FilterWildcard(string str, string userID = "", object data = null),例:"$datarow&id&$".FilterWildcard("",DataRow);
表单控件默认值使用通配符:<%="$querystring&flowid&$".FilterWildcard()%>
例:
运行时:
其他SQL语句使用就直接写,不需要手工调用后面的方法如:select * from workflow where id='$querystring&flowid&$',运行时会自动将通配符替换为地址栏中的flowid参数值。
联系QQ:493501010电话:136 0832 5512(微信同号)邮箱:road@roadflow.net
Copyright 2014 - 2024 重庆天知软件技术有限公司 版权所有
|